Hue Jackson already knows what left side of the O-line will look like

BEREA, OH – Finding a suitable replacement for future Hall of Famer Joe Thomas at left tackle has been the Browns biggest dilemma this offseason. Now, just days away from their season-opening showdown with the Pittsburgh Steelers, it’s still a mystery.

Veteran Joel Bitonio took one for the team by moving to left tackle during the preseason and remains an option for filling the void. That could be counterintuitive though, considering he’s spent the first four years of his career at left guard. That’s obviously where he is most comfortable, which is why a move back to his natural position is also in play ahead of Sunday.
